Great Expectations, Good Zoo by Sean Carley

My wife and I love zoos. We visit them every chance we get. The Toledo Zoo looked good enough to make me wait 3 hours for it to open in a town I knew nothing about. The suggestion that it is the 7th best zoo in the country had my expectations quite high.

The zoo we found did not live up to my expectations but was well worth the visit. Several of the exhibits deserve an honorable mention on Ultimate Zoos with the seal and polar bear exhibits standing out. Something let me down a bit though. I felt this zoo was more about the people visiting than it was about the animals living there. It was subtle but I felt it could have been better.

I would like to go back when I am not exhausted by the road (I had been driving since 1 AM when we hit Toledo) but you should definitely take a look here if you get a chance.
